Police launch investigation into firearms incident
Police appealed for witnesses after a firearms incident in Devonshire last night.
It is understood that nobody was injured in the incident, which happened in the Devon Springs Road area at about 11.30pm.
A police spokesman said that officers searched the scene and “recovered evidence to confirm a firearm had been discharged in that area”.
He added: “There were no reports of anyone being injured in this incident and checks with medical facilities indicated no one attended seeking treatment for a firearms-related injury.”
